About N-[[4-[[1H-benzimidazol-2-ylmethyl(5,6,7,8-tetrahydroquinolin-8-yl)amino]methyl]phenyl]methyl]benzenesulfonamide

N-[[4-[[1H-benzimidazol-2-ylmethyl(5,6,7,8-tetrahydroquinolin-8-yl)amino]methyl]phenyl]methyl]benzenesulfonamide (PubChem CID 10119565) has the molecular formula C31H31N5O2S and a molecular weight of 537.69 g/mol. Its IUPAC name is N-[[4-[[1H-benzimidazol-2-ylmethyl(5,6,7,8-tetrahydroquinolin-8-yl)amino]methyl]phenyl]methyl]benzenesulfonamide.
